Located about 12 miles north of Cardiff, the town of Pontypridd is in a great central location if you want to explore all that South Wales has to offer. Affectionately known as ‘Ponty’ by the locals, this lush green getaway is just a short drive from the nearest airport and train station.

Best time to go to Pontypridd

The best time to visit Pontypridd is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January40.5°F (4.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February41.0°F (5.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
March43.3°F (6.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April46.9°F (8.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
May52.2°F (11.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
June57.4°F (14.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July60.4°F (15.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August59.7°F (15.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
September56.7°F (13.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
October52.2°F (11.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
November46.2°F (7.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
December42.8°F (6.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low

What's the seasonal weather in Pontypridd?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 15°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Pontypridd is 1112 mm.
